JDA Issues Notices to Illegal Commercial Establishments in Residential Areas
The Jaipur Development Authority (JDA) has begun taking action against illegal commercial activities in residential zones following a Supreme Court directive. Notices have been served to establishments operating without proper approvals, aiming to curb the misuse of residential land.

Jaipur Grapples with Severe Water Crisis Due to Leaking Bisalpur Pipeline
Jaipur is facing a critical water shortage despite the Bisalpur Dam being full. The crisis is attributed to 33 major leaks in the 17-year-old Bisalpur pipeline and lack of long-term planning. The infrastructure, designed for the city's 2021 population, is struggling to meet the demands of 2026.
Union Government approves Jaipur Metro Rail Project Phase II
The Union Government has approved the Jaipur Metro Rail Project Phase II, a 41 km corridor with an investment of Rs 130.38 billion. This project aims to provide seamless connectivity to key areas like Sitapura Industrial Area, Vishwakarma Industrial Area, and the Jaipur Airport, integrating with Phase I to create a unified metro network.

Jaipur Metro Phase 2 Construction Bids Received, Tonk Road Corridor to Begin Soon
Rajasthan Metro Rail Corporation Limited has received bids from 13 infrastructure companies for the first civil construction package of Jaipur Metro Phase 2. The tender, valued at around Rs 1145 crores, includes the design and construction of an elevated viaduct with 10 elevated stations. Also , Tonk road Metro line corridor will begin soon connecting Airport and commercial zones on Tonk Road to City.
